NASA's 1st Deep-Space Capsule in 40 Years Ready for Launch Debut

Tuesday, December 2, 2014 - 12:00 in Astronomy & Space

NASA's Orion space capsule is scheduled to travel 3,600 miles from Earth on Dec. 4, then rocket back to Earth to test out a variety of systems during an unmanned flight. No human-spaceflight vehicle has traveled so far since 1972.
